Is there any way to get away from libcurl4 dependencies? I run Ubuntu 6 and libcurl4 isn't available as packages through the normal repositories. I do not want to do a full dist-upgrade just to be able to run the latest rtorrent svn.

See the last two replies on the bug tracker: http:// libtorrent.rakshasa.no/ticket/1462#comment:4 - it's also not that hard to build your own updated libcurl4 package. I just did that for my Debian etch install, Ubuntu probably isn't much different.

The minimum possible libcurl version is 7.15.4, though upgrading to a recent libcurl is still strongly recommended, because rtorrent now uses libcurl's poll interface which wasn't deemed "stable" until 7.18.x.

Or stay with 0.12.3/0.8.3 for now (as opposed to the latest svn revision).
